Calcitonin

Ordering Information

A stimulation test (calcium or pentagastrin) is required when used for diagnostic purposes.

Notes

Please note: Test cannot be added on, as specimen must be collected on ice.

Storage Instructions
Store serum frozen at - 20°C
Additional (Storage) Instructions

Instructions for: Metropolitan and Regional Specimen Receptions

  • Calcitonin is extremely labile. Centrifuge, aliquot, and freeze serum within 24 hours of collection.
Transport Instructions
Transport frozen
